Part of the Open Door series of short books for emerging readers. Sixteen-year-old Miriam gets her first summer job at an all-in holiday resort in North County Dublin. When she arrives she meets Marie-Claire, and finds a friendship that will change her life forever. Narrated by a grown-up Miriam, Heart of Gold explores the nature of growing up, friendship and betrayal.
Catherine Dunne was born in Dublin and studied English and Spanish at Trinity College. Catherine is the author of several novels and a non-fiction book, An Unconsidered People: The Irish in London, which was published by New Island in 2003.
